When you are preparing for a trip to a tourist destination, there are several things that you should consider taking with you to ensure that you have an enjoyable and comfortable experience. Here are some essential items to pack:
1. Comfortable Shoes
Depending on the destination, you may be doing a lot of walking or hiking, so be sure to bring a comfortable pair of shoes that you can wear all day.
2. Appropriate Clothing
Pack clothing that is appropriate for the weather and the activities you have planned. Consider packing layers if you are visiting a destination with unpredictable weather.
3. Sunscreen and Sunglasses
Protect your skin and eyes from the sun’s harmful UV rays by packing sunscreen and sunglasses.
4. Camera and Smartphone
Capture memories of your trip by packing a camera or using your smartphone to take photos and videos.
5. Travel Adapter
If you are traveling to a different country, be sure to pack a travel adapter so that you can charge your electronics.
6. First Aid Kit
Bring a small first aid kit with things like bandages, painkillers, and antibacterial wipes.
7. Snacks and Water
Bring some snacks and a reusable water bottle to keep you hydrated and energized while you explore.
8. Maps and Guidebooks
Do your research before your trip and pack any maps or guidebooks that will help you navigate your destination and plan your itinerary.
Remember, the items you pack will depend on your destination and the activities you have planned. It’s always a good idea to check the weather forecast and research the local customs and culture to ensure that you pack appropriately.

Q2. What is the best time of year to visit Cancun for tourists?
The best time to visit Cancun for tourists is generally between December and April, when the weather is sunny and dry, and the temperatures are comfortable. However, this is also peak tourist season, so expect crowds and higher prices. May through November is considered the off-season, with more rain and higher temperatures, but also lower prices and fewer crowds.
Q3. Are there any safety concerns for tourists visiting Cancun, Mexico?
Like any popular tourist destination, Cancun does have some safety concerns for visitors. It is important to be aware of your surroundings and take precautions, such as not carrying large amounts of cash or valuable items, staying in well-lit and populated areas, and avoiding walking alone at night. It is also recommended to only use authorized taxis and to avoid drinking tap water. However, overall Cancun is a safe destination for tourists who take reasonable precautions.
